Routing and kppp headache on RH 9



I am going crazy.  My kppp doesn't seem to want to set the default router.

Internal network
192.168.2.1-150  Actually only 4 systems
Linux router has address of 192.168.2.1

I have kppp set to act as the default router.
When the system dials in the local is xxx.xxx.xxx.174
The remote is xxx.xxx.xxx.10

I am using masquerading with the local network pointing to ppp0

When connected I can ping from any system including the fw/router/ppp host
192.168.2.1
192.168.2.x where x is any system on the local network
Xxx.xxx.xxx.174 local ppp address from ISP
Xxx.xxx.xxx.10 remote ppp address from ISP

I cannot ping anything outside of ISP.  I get destination unreachable.

It is like I do not have a default route set or my ISP is stopping me.  If I
connect any of the machines directly with dial up networking, everything
seems to work (except the fw/router/ppp host)

What am I do wrong.  I do have the defaultrouter box checked in kppp.
